District Overview

United School District is a public school district serving Armagh area, Pennsylvania. For academic year 2020-2021, 2 schools served 1,030 students through PK to 12th grade in its 2 schools. A total of 85 teachers are teaching their students and the average students to teacher ratio is 12 to 1.

According to the Pennsylvania state assessment result, 51% of students are proficient in Math learning and 68%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 85 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for schools in United School District and the students to teacher ratio is 12 to 1. All teachers are certified. 98.8%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
